The cuisine of Odisha is specially impacted by recipes developed and used by temple cooks for thousands and thousands of years. The prasad offered to famous Lord Jagannath is called Mahaprasad or Avada or Chappan Bhoga. Chappan Bhoga means 56 variety of Mahaprasada is part of daily offerings to Lord Jagannath. One of the dishes from Mahaprasad is Kanika.
Kanika is a mildly sweet and extremely flavorful, no onion-garlic pulao made with basmati rice, ghee, dry fruits, sugar/jaggery, and whole spices. Despite the fact that the recipe is very simple with few ingredients, the essential highlights are never to be disregarded. The essential component of the recipe is the very much isolated puffed grains embellished with an ideal sparkle from the Ghee.
